The Sofia Regional Prosecutor’s Office has announced that it has instituted pre-trial proceedings based on a report of stalking and a threat on the life of a prosecutor from the Specialized Prosecutor’s Office. According to unconfirmed information the prosecutor in question is Angel Kanev, in whose cabinet an envelope with a bullet inside has been found, along with paper clippings with the words “blood” and “informed”.
The prosecutor has worked on major cases of significant public interest, among them that of fugitive businessman Vassil Bojkov, and has had a security detail for two years. Deputy Minister of Justice Emil Dechev called for the incident not to be politicized.
